Trend Micro appoints new Aussie MD

Trend Micro today announced that it has appointed Sanjay Mehta as the new managing director for its Australian and New Zealand operations.

Mehta is currently vice president of Emerging Products for Trend Micro in California. He will move to Australia and start as the Australian head on 1 July 2012.

Mehta has been at Trend Micro since 2010 with his current role, and later also took on the role of vice president of global sales enablement. Before starting at Trend Micro, he was CEO of Breach Security until its acquisition by Trustwave.

"I am excited to be taking up the new position with Trend Micro ANZ, which has emerged as one of the largest and most dynamic markets for Trend Micro globally," Mehta said. "I look forward to maintaining our leadership in the core areas of cloud security, virtualisation and internet security."

The current Australia and New Zealand managing director, Dave Patnaik, will leave the company to head overseas for a "senior role".

"Under his leadership, Trend Micro doubled its revenues and is now a leader in cloud security, and ranked among the top two software security vendors in Australia. We wish him all the best for his future endeavours," Eva Chen, CEO of Trend Micro, said.
